History / Notes

An Ansari chief from the Aws tribe. He was one of the two martyrs from the Aws at the Battle of Badr (the other being his father, Khaythamah). He was known for his generosity; he and his father drew lots to see who would go to Badr, and he went and was martyred. The Prophet ﷺ paired him with the Muhajir Umar ibn al-Khattab as brothers in faith.
